Cowboys Activating QB Andy Dalton & DL Tyrone Crawford From COVID-19 List

Cowboys HC Mike McCarthy announced Wednesday that QB Andy Dalton and DL Tyrone Crawford will be activated from the COVID-19 list later today.

Both players are expected to suit up for the Cowboys in Week 11.

The Cowboys are also designating OT Brandon Knight to return from injured reserve.

Dalton, 32, is a former second-round pick of the Bengals back in 2011. He was entering the final year of his seven-year, $97.09 million contract, which included $17 million guaranteed when Cincinnati cut him loose. 

Dalton stood to make a base salary of $17.5 million in 2020 when the Bengals opted to release him. He signed a one-year deal with the Cowboys back in May. 

In 2020, he’s appeared in four games and recorded 52 completions on 85 pass attempts (61.2 percent) for 452 yards, one touchdown, and three interceptions.  

Crawford, 30, is a former third-round pick of the Cowboys back in 2012. He’s entering the final year of his six-year, $45.675 million contract that included $17.425 million guaranteed and stands to make a base salary of $8 million in 2020.

In 2020, Crawford has appeared in nine games for the Cowboys and recorded five tackles and no sacks.
